Section courante

A propos

Section administrative du site

 Serveur  Installation  Utilisation  Tutoriel  Programmation  Annexe  Aide 
Vue par liste complète
Installation
Introduction
Configuration de multiples sites Web
Modules
mod_access_compat
mod_actions
mod_alias
mod_cgi
mod_http2
mod_md
mod_perl
mod_proxy
mod_sed
mod_session
mod_setenvif
mod_ssl
mod_rewrite
Réglage du paramètre MaxClients d'Apache sur un site à haut trafic
PHP
APACHE_CHILD_TERMINATE
APACHE_GET_MODULES
APACHE_GET_VERSION
APACHE_GETENV
APACHE_LOOKUP_URI
APACHE_NOTE
APACHE_REQUEST_HEADERS
APACHE_RESET_TIMEOUT
APACHE_RESPONSE_HEADERS
APACHE_SETENV
Référence des codes d'erreur
Format de fichier: httpd.conf
Format de fichier: .htaccess
Préface
Notes légal
Dictionnaire
Recherche
Fiche technique
Type de produit : Module

mod_perl

Le module mod_perl réunit toute la puissance du langage de programmation Perl et du serveur HTTP Apache. Vous pouvez utiliser Perl pour gérer Apache, répondre aux demandes de pages Web et bien plus encore.

Liste des directives

Nom Description
PerlAddVar Cette directive permet d'indiquer si vous devez transmettre plusieurs valeurs dans la même variable émulant des tableaux et des hachages.
PerlConfigRequire Cette directive fait la même chose que PerlPostConfigRequire, mais il est exécuté dès qu'il est rencontré, c'est-à-dire pendant la phase de configuration.
PerlLoadModule Cette directive est similaire à PerlModule, en ce sens qu'elle charge un module.
PerlModule Cette directive permet de charger des modules en utilisant leurs noms de paquet.
PerlOptions Cette directive permet de fournir une configuration fine pour ce qui n'était que des options de compilation dans la première génération de mod_perl. Il permet également de contrôler quelle classe de bassin d'interpréteurs Perl est utilisée pour un VirtualHost ou un emplacement configuré avec Location, Directory,...
PerlPostConfigRequire Cette directive permet de charger des fichiers avec du code Perl à exécuter au démarrage du serveur. Il n'est pas exécuté dès qu'il est rencontré, mais le plus tard possible lors du démarrage du serveur.
PerlRequire Cette directive fait la même chose que PerlPostConfigRequire, mais vous n'avez pratiquement aucun contrôle sur le moment où ce code va être exécuté. Par conséquent, vous devriez plutôt utiliser PerlConfigRequire (s'exécute immédiatement) ou PerlPostConfigRequire (s'exécute juste avant la fin du démarrage du serveur). La plupart du temps, vous souhaitez utiliser ce dernier.
PerlSetEnv Cette directive permet d'indiquer des variables d'environnement système et de les transmettre à vos gestionnaires mod_perl. Ces valeurs sont ensuite disponibles via les mécanismes «perl %ENV» normaux.
PerlSetVar Cette directive permet de passer des variables dans vos gestionnaires mod_perl depuis votre httpd.conf.
PerlSwitches Cette directive permet de passer n'importe quel commutateur de ligne de commande Perl dans httpd.conf en utilisant la directive PerlSwitches.
SetHandler Cette directive permet de fournir deux types de gestionnaires SetHandler : modperl et perl-script. La directive SetHandler n'est pertinente que pour les gestionnaires de phase de réponse. Cela n'affecte pas les autres phases.



PARTAGER CETTE PAGE SUR
Dernière mise à jour : Lundi, le 27 février 2023